The key elements include the virgin Mary being visited by the angel Gabriel, Joseph's role as Mary's betrothed and his acceptance of the situation through an angelic visitation in a dream. Also, the journey to Bethlehem due to the census, Jesus' birth in a manger, the angels announcing the birth to the shepherds, and the wise men following the star to bring gifts.

One main theme is redemption. Scrooge goes from being a miserly and cold - hearted man to a kind and generous one. Another theme is the importance of Christmas spirit, which is about love, giving, and community. Also, there's the theme of memory and how our past experiences shape us, as shown by the Ghost of Christmas Past.
The main characters are Ebenezer Scrooge, a miserly old man; Jacob Marley, Scrooge's former business partner who appears as a ghost; and the three spirits - the Ghost of Christmas Past, the Ghost of Christmas Present, and the Ghost of Christmas Yet to Come. Also, the Cratchit family is important, especially Bob Cratchit, Scrooge's underpaid clerk.
